bedtime story ideas for 21 month old

30 replies

pinkglitter80 · 18/09/2014 14:05

hi - does anyone have ideas for this please? she's had the same two stories for ever and seems to be getting bored.... thanks!

yes we're library members... was wondering about Julia Donaldson as we have room on the broom and the gruffalo but she gets bored before the end - are there shorter ones?

OP posts:
CeliaBowen · 18/09/2014 16:00

Meg and Mog are fab, I think both JD and JK are a bit long for that age.

JuniperTisane · 18/09/2014 16:08

There are some shorter Julia Donaldson ones - Tales from Acorn Wood. Neither of my boys rated them much though.

DS2 is 20m and his current favourites are

Wow Said The Owl
This is the Bear and the Picnic Lunch
Goodnight Moon
Apple Tree Farm series
Hairy McClary series

Peppa pig books are short enough for them at that age (dd2 is 21 months) but keeps interest.

We also have a couple of singing books which she loves before bed. Hickory Dickory Dock with a little mouse puppet and 10 bears in a bed.

I think the Julia Donaldson books etc are way to old for this age!!! From around 3 they are good.

Favourites for my girls at this age were:

Guess How Much I Love You
Goodnight Moon (there are 2 other books along the same lines too but I don't think they are as good)
Noisy Farm
Hairy Maclary series
The Very Busy Spider
Spot series
My Mum and also My Dad, both books by Anthony Browne
Brown Bear Brown Bear, What Do You See?
That's Not My... series

It wasn't long after that age before they got into Julia Donaldson and Judith Kerr books. Mick Inkpen writes some great books for kids from around 2 years old. Wibbly Pig, This Is My Book, Kipper story collection.

Pounamu · 21/09/2014 09:51

Sorry, just to add - anything by Martin Waddell or Michael Rosen, they are great children's authors
